Sexual Offense Response Team (SORT)

Membership includes representatives from: Counseling Center, Resident Education and Development, University Health Services, University Ombuds, Public Safety, Women’s Center, University Judicial Affairs, Athletics, General Counsel, Office of Equal Opportunity, Communications, students, and faculty. 

Goal #1: Educate the community about the prevalence of sexual violence among college students 

  • Objective 1: Maintain & disseminate statistics on reported sex and gender-based offenses 
  • Objective 2: Ensure that the Student Right to Know is updated with sexual offense crime statistics (per Clery) 
  • Objective 3:  Issue university-wide educational reports quarterly

Goal #2: Inform the community of related campus services and reporting options available to respond

  • Objective 1:  Issue university-wide educational reports quarterly
  • Objective 2:Maintain updated information on SORT webpage

Goal #3: Ensure university policies and procedures are updated and in line with best practices.

  • Objective 1: Meet quarterly to review and evaluate relevant university policies and procedures
  • Objective 2:  Make recommendations for improved policies and procedures
